首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用于显示错误的"if“语句tkinter.messagebox不工作

如果要在Python中使用tkinter库中的if语句来显示错误消息框(messagebox),可以采取以下步骤:

  1. 导入必要的模块和库:
代码语言:txt
复制
import tkinter as tk
from tkinter import messagebox
  1. 创建一个主窗口对象:
代码语言:txt
复制
root = tk.Tk()
  1. 定义一个函数来处理错误和显示错误消息框:
代码语言:txt
复制
def display_error():
    if condition:  # 替换为你的条件
        messagebox.showerror("错误", "错误消息")  # 替换为你的错误消息
  1. 创建一个按钮来触发错误消息框的显示:
代码语言:txt
复制
button = tk.Button(root, text="显示错误", command=display_error)
button.pack()
  1. 进入主循环,等待用户操作:
代码语言:txt
复制
root.mainloop()

这样,当用户点击“显示错误”按钮并且满足条件时,错误消息框将弹出显示错误消息。

关于tkinter库和messagebox的更多信息,你可以参考腾讯云的产品介绍链接:

注意:本答案遵循题目要求,不涉及云计算品牌商的产品推荐。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券